Output 2390b375fcb60bfaedfa26a40a37fe6eb760c993ad615c4614908dc2d6d1d017:2

value
1105262
script pubkey
OP_0 OP_PUSHBYTES_20 c54c93142c5335d8c003c94f756888f6d021faae
address
bc1qc4xfx9pv2v6a3sqre98h26yg7mgzr74wqpsnwt
transaction
2390b375fcb60bfaedfa26a40a37fe6eb760c993ad615c4614908dc2d6d1d017
spent
true